Le 17 mai 1763, le mariage du marquis et de Renée-Pélagie, fille aînée de Cordier de Montreuil, président honoraire à la cour des Aides de Paris, de petite noblesse de robe, mais dont la fortune dépasse largement celle des Sade, est câelébré à Paris en l'église Saint-Roch. Les conditions financières ont été âprement négociées ...

Je poste, en particulier, deux tristes photos de la tombe de la Marquise de Sade et de sa fille. Non seulement, elle a, pour arrière-plan, de sinistres éoliennes mais elle est en piteux état : on n'arrive même plus à déchiffrer les inscriptions. Mon petit post se veut donc un modeste appel à sa restauration.

The religious ceremony was at last held on Mav 17, in the church of Saint-Roch. txeuils What of Donatien's new bride.> Renee-Pelagie de Sade, whom he did not meet until the eve of their wedding, was not endowed with those attributes then called ''physical graces." Only one portrait of her survives, an inepdy drawn profile of very doubtful origin.
